Interesting facts about Canada:
- The border between the US and Canada is the longest in the world. Its length is 8,891 km.
- Canada has the longest coastline in the world - 202,080 km.
- Canada is the most educated country in the world: more than half of its citizens have higher education.
- Canada has more lakes than in all other countries combined.
- Canada still has a monarchy. King Charles III became the monarch of Canada when Queen Elizabeth II passed in 2022.
- Most of Canada has less earth-gravity power than the rest of the Earth. This phenomenon was discovered in the 1960s.
- Canada ranks third in terms of oil reserves, after Saudi Arabia and Venezuela.
- One of the national parks of Canada (Wood Buffalo National Park) is larger than the whole territory of Switzerland.
- On the island of Newfoundland, there are 500-600 collisions of moose with vehicles annually.
- Canada is 3 times larger than India by territory but 36 times smaller than India by population.
- Toronto is Canada's largest city.
- A huge number of things were invented in Canada, the most significant are: basketball, insulin, electric wheelchair, peanut butter, the pacemaker, wireless radio transmission and much more.
